Resultados da pesquisa a pedido "casting"

1 a resposta

Problemas "Ponteiro do número inteiro / inteiro do ponteiro sem conversão"

Esta pergunta pretende ser uma entrada de FAQ para todas as inicializações / atribuições entre problemas de número inteiro e ponteiro. Quero escrever código em que um ponteiro esteja definido para um endereço de memória específico, por ...

3 a resposta

É legal reutilizar a memória de uma matriz de tipos fundamental para uma matriz de tipos diferente (mas ainda fundamental)

Este é um acompanhamento para este outroPergunta, questão [https://stackoverflow.com/q/51930334/3545273]sobre a reutilização de memória. Como a pergunta original era sobre uma implementação específica, a resposta estava relacionada a essa ...

2 a resposta

Elenco incorreto - é o elenco ou o uso que é um comportamento indefinido

Se eu faço uma conversão de um tipo Base para um tipo Derivado, mas o tipo Base não é uma instância do tipo derivado, mas só uso o resultado se for, recebo um comportamento indefinido? Difícil de entender o que estou perguntando? dê uma olhada ...

2 a resposta

Como imprimir o nome dos símbolos dos arquivos ELF como o nm?

Eu sei que o nome dos símbolos estão no shstrtab. Mas eu não entendo como pegá-los. Devo converter meu shstrab em um Elf64_Sym para poder usar o st_name? Elf64_Shdr *shdr = (Elf64_Shdr *) (data + elf->e_shoff); Elf64_Shdr *symtab; Elf64_Shdr ...

1 a resposta

Objeto Typsescript de json casting para type

Na vida cotidiana, preciso ler alguns json do ajax e convertê-los em algum objeto digitado (incluindo seus métodos). Na internet, encontrei e usei o seguinte código para digitar casting: export class Obj { public static cast<T>(obj, type: { ...

1 a resposta

Captura de ClassCastException em um método genérico ao executar conversão genérica

Suponha que eu tenha um método @SuppressWarnings("unchecked") public <T extends Number> T getNumber() { try { return (T)number; } catch (ClassCastException e) { return null; } } Assumindonumber é uma instância deInteger, invocando método ...

1 a resposta

Comportamento diferente entre elenco explícito, inicialização direta e inicialização de cópia

Eu tenho aulaC que tem um operador de casting para qualquer coisa. No exemplo, tentei lançar uma instância dele parastd::string de três maneiras diferentes:static_castconstrutor destd::string e atribuindo astd::string. No entanto, apenas o último ...

1 a resposta

Angular: resposta JSON de conversão de tipo de documento como modelo de objeto não está funcionando

Eu tenho um problema enquanto tento transmitir uma resposta json ao objeto, todas as propriedades do meu objeto são string, isso é normal? Aqui está o meu pedido de ajax: public getSingle = (keys: any[]): Observable<Badge> => { ...

1 a resposta

Conversão de numpy float32 para float64

Eu quero executar algumas operações padrão em numpyfloat32 matrizes em python 3, no entanto, estou vendo algum comportamento estranho ao trabalhar com numpysum(). Aqui está uma sessão de exemplo: Python 3.6.1 |Anaconda 4.4.0 (x86_64)| (default, ...

2 a resposta

Maneira limpa de mapear objetos para outros objetos?

Existe uma boa maneira de mapear objetos para outros objetos? As recomendações da biblioteca também são bem-vindas. Por exemplo, digamos que eu tenho essas classes: export class Draft { id: number; name: string; summary: string; } export ...